Bed Bug Control

Having bed bugs in your mattresses, sofa, or carpets can be uncomfortable and unpleasant. Bed bugs feed using a stylet, a mouthpart that pierces our skin to obtain blood. They can leave red, swelling bite marks on your skin. Bites can trigger rashes or other skin reactions for those with sensitive skin. Brown Recluse Removal & Extermination

In most cases, the Brown Recluse you’ll find in Lansing, IL isn’t very large. Usually, the brown recluse measures between half an inch and one inch in size. It can be identified by its noticeable brown color and the marking running down its back. Some people say that this stripe resembles the shape of a violin, which is why the brown recluse is often called the brown fiddler.
